Ingredients You’ll Need

To make the Vanilla Cranberry Christmas Latte, gather these ingredients:

  • 1 cup oat milk
  • 1/3 cup cranberry juice
  • 1/2 tsp vanilla bean paste
  • 1 shot espresso
  • Fresh cranberries for garnish

STEP-BY-STEP INSTRUCTIONS

  1. Heat the Oat Milk and Cranberry Juice: In a steamer or a small saucepan, combine the oat milk and cranberry juice. Keep it over medium heat. Stir gently to mix the ingredients.
  2. Add the Vanilla: Once the mixture is warm, add the vanilla bean paste. Stir again and let it heat for a minute or two, but make sure it does not boil.
  3. Prepare the Espresso: While the oat milk and cranberry juice are heating, brew a shot of espresso using your coffee machine or espresso maker.
  4. Combine the Ingredients: Pour the warm oat milk and cranberry juice mixture into a mug. Add the freshly brewed espresso to the mug. Give it a good stir to mix everything well.
  5. Garnish with Cranberries: Top your latte with fresh cranberries for a festive touch. You may also add a sprinkle of cinnamon or nutmeg if you like.

STORAGE & FREEZING : Vanilla Cranberry Christmas Latte

The Vanilla Cranberry Christmas Latte tastes best when freshly made. However, if you want to prepare some ingredients in advance, you can store them:

  • Oat Milk and Cranberry Juice Mixture: You can mix the oat milk and cranberry juice ahead of time and keep it in the fridge for up to two days. Just give it a good stir before heating it again.
  • Espresso: Brewed espresso is best fresh, but if you have leftovers, store it in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a day. Reheat it before adding to your latte.

It is not recommended to freeze the drink because the texture may change when thawed.

VARIATIONS

To make your Vanilla Cranberry Christmas Latte unique, consider these variations:

  • Use Different Milk: Almond milk or soy milk can work well if you prefer them over oat milk.
  • Add Flavors: You can add peppermint extract for a minty twist or other flavored syrups for extra sweetness.
  • Sweeten to Taste: Feel free to mix in some honey or sugar to suit your sweetness preference.
  • Make it Iced: If you prefer cold drinks, let the mixture cool down, add ice, and blend for an iced version.

FAQs

1. Can I use regular milk instead of oat milk?

Yes, you can use any type of milk you like. Dairy milk or any plant-based milk works well.

2. Is there a non-caffeine version of this latte?

Yes, you can make it without espresso by using decaffeinated coffee or simply enjoying it without any coffee for a flavorful drink.

3. How can I make my latte frothy?

Using a milk frother or shaking the warm oat milk and cranberry juice in a jar can help create froth.

4. Can I make this latte vegan?

Yes, as long as you use plant-based ingredients like oat milk and avoid honey, this recipe is vegan-friendly.
